Subject: Re: [PATCH v2 4/7] clk: exynos5420: Rename clock names
Date: Tue, 15 Apr 2014 19:05:33 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<534D66DD.30503@gmail.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1395918470-16374-5-git-send-email-shaik.ameer@samsung.com>

Hi Shaik,

On 27.03.2014 12:07, Shaik Ameer Basha wrote:
> From: Rahul Sharma <rahul.sharma@samsung.com>
>
> Maintain the mout_, dout_, sclk_ prefix to the clock names
> wherever applicable.

Looking at the patch, it does seem to do more than that. Considering my 
comments to patch 3/7, I would drop the renames simply adding *CLK_ 
prefix (except SCLK_, which is fine as it specifies clock type, just as 
MOUT_/DOUT_/etc.).

Best regards,
Tomasz
